Beef And Burgundy 60’s Dinner Dance

beef and burgundy 1 oct 14The Community Centre is hosting a special “fun(d) raiser” for Friedreich Ataxia, a degenerative neurological disease.

This event will be held in the Community Hall on Saturday, November 1, 6.30 for 7pm.

One of the organisers, Helen Brown, says, “For the cost of the $25 ticket you will receive dinner, wine and of course the traditional 60’s dessert.”

As per the 60’s theme, there will be nibbles on the tables, raffles and thanks to several Gympie musicians, there will be music to get you into a party mood for some enthusiastic dancing.

“It should be a great night, so get out your party gear and join in the fun. If you don’t dance drink, if you don’t drink eat and talk.”

Friedreich Ataxia is usually diagnosed in children between the ages of 5 and 15, and causes difficulty in walking, talking and everyday functions.

Tickets are available at the community centre, so get together with friends and come out for a great night of relaxation.
